海州湾坛子网网囊网目选择性研究

使用套网法在海州湾海域进行了坛子网3种网目尺寸(30、35和40 mm)的网囊网目选择性试验.在分析渔获物组成的基础上,基于Logistic选择模型和数量生物量曲线(Abundance-biomass comparison curves,AIBC曲线)法,获得了渔获物中主要经济品种小黄鱼(Pseudosciaena pol yactis)、鹰爪虾(Trach ypenaeus curvirostris)和口虾蛄(Oratosquilla oratoria de Haan)的选择性曲线和ABC曲线.结果表明,坛子网网囊网目尺寸为30、35和40 mm时,小黄鱼的50%选择体长(L50)分别为7.920、9.503和11.229 cm,选择范围(SR)分别为1.975、2.306和3.775 cm;鹰爪虾的(Ls0)值分别为5.400、5.901和7.404cm,其SR值分别为1.283、1.376和1.709 cm;口虾蛄的Ls0值分别为7.844、8.324和9.602 cm,其SR值分别为2.680、2.719和2.973 cm;随着网目尺寸逐渐增大,小黄鱼、鹰爪虾和口虾蛄选择性指标50%选择体长(L50)和选择范围SR值也随之逐渐增大.3种坛子网试验网囊内ABC曲线W值均小于0,表明针对海州湾目前整体生物群落,网囊网目尺寸需要进一步放大.本研究结果可为中国黄海区渔业资源可持续发展及张网网囊最小网目尺寸的确定提供科学参考.
A Study on the Selectivity of Codend Mesh of Tanzi Net in Haizhou Bay
Tanzi net is a kind of double stake stow net.It is a traditional fishing gear in Haizhou Bay.On account of its lower cost,lower energy consumption and stable output,Tanzi net fishing has already become an important method.Because of its small mesh size of codend,a lot of young fish or shrimp are often caught.Such shortage has seriously negative influenced the offing fish resource.So it is necessary to carry out study on the selectivity of Tanzi net.It is the basal work of the study on the minimal mesh size of Tanzi net in Haizhou Bay.Referred to relevant research data,there is seldom studies on the size selectivity of stow net in Haizhou Bay.The selectivity of codend mesh of Tanzi with several mesh sizes (30,35 and 40mm) has been tested by using the cover-net method in Haizhou bay.Because the AIC value of the Logistic model is relatively smaller than that of other models and the model is the conventional used in researches on the selectivity of fishing gear,the Logistic model was selected as the selectivity model of this experiment.Also,abundance-biomass comparison curve (ABC curve) and biomass spectrum method were applied to analyzing the data too.Based on the analyses of the catches composition and the Logistic equation model and ABC curve,the authors obtained W value and the selectivity curve of the main economic varieties,P.polyactis,T.curvirostris and O.oratoria de Haan.Parameters of selectivity were estimated with the maximum likelihood method.The result showed that the 50% selection length,Ls0,of P.polyactis was 7.920,9.503 and 11.229 cm,and the selection range (SR) was 1.975,2.306 and 3.775 cm,respectively,when the mesh size was 30,35 and 40 rm;the L50of T.curvirostris was 5.400,5.901,7.404 cm and the SR was 1.283,1.376 and 1.709 cm,respectively,when the mesh size was 30,35 and 40 mm;the L50 of O.oratoria de Haan were 7.844,8.324 and 9.602 cm,and the SR was 2.680,2.719 and 2.973 cm,respectively,when the mesh size was 30,35 and 40 mm.Enlarging the mesh size of TanZi net increased the L50 and the SR of P.polyactis,T.curvirostris and O.oratoria de Haan.The W value of the three codend meshes was less than 0 in terms of the whole biological community of the Gulf of Haizhou at present,which implied that mesh size needs to be further enlarged.Based on the database,the selectivity of the Tanzi net fishery is poorer,the amount of by-catch is too large.It was suggested to take some feasible modification on fishery nets for protecting fishery resource.The research results were applicable in the fishery resources sustainable development in the Yellow Sea region and also provided the scientific reference to the minimum mesh size of the codend net.
